Underwriting Assistant
Ipswich UK
At AXA XL we solve todays complex risks to drive tomorrows innovation. We see our careers with AXA XL as a chance to unleash our potential globally. Cultivate expertise. Collaborate constantly. Analyse deeper. Dream bigger.
Joining AXA XL as an Underwriting Assistant is a great foundation step to launch your career within insurance. Whether you have some basic Insurance experience and are ready to take the next step up want to change your direction within Insurance or are looking for your first step on the ladder we have plenty of support available to help you take that next step. Starting your career can be a daunting adventure at AXA XL we have industry experts and a market leading Underwriting Academy to support you on that learning journey.
The Middle Office Operations team are responsible for ensuring that operational tasks undertaken by Shared Services / Global Operations are managed appropriately provide support to Underwriting and ensure that the administrative processes for the endtoend policy lifecycle are run efficiently and at a high quality to serve internal and external clients. Within this role you will primarily be responsible for supporting Retail lines of business.
The teams support the design and delivery of strategic change initiatives affecting the Underwriting business. Example projects include the operational design strategy for Brexit the design and of an offshore service centre move between countries and supporting the data and system workstreams for a new legal entity creation.
DISCOVER your opportunity
What will your essential responsibilities include
Assisting Underwriters in recording risk details on source systems; building broker relationships as required; developing knowledge of the class of business and the accounts written; retrieving data for Underwriters as requested accurately and on time
Liaise with underwriters to ensure correct interpretation of data for accuracy and completeness
Maintain underwriting documentation/files; keeping all documentation in order
Liaise with the Credit Control team answering queries tracking and monitoring premium using core underwriting systems.
Work with and build relationships with underwriting support functions to respond to regular control and exception reports including data entry and ensure adherence to common standards across the business
Work with underwriting team to develop requirements for statistical and insightful reports for Underwriting function
Monitor renewal lists and coordinate as required
Support delegated underwriting renewal process alongside underwriters pricing claims and governance
Work closely with shared services to ensure accurate and timely service to our Underwriters and Clients
Other adhoc duties and projects
You will report into Team Leader Middle Office
